    Learn2 Cornwall - an alternative to college provision for post 16.

    A small specialist post-16 education provider based just outside Penzance. This provision is for young people with an EHCP. We offer life skills, cover many areas of the preparing for adulthood outcomes/themes, work experience and much more.
